N=int(input()) S=input().strip() ans = N - S.index("#") cnt=0 mx=0 for i in range(N): if S[i]=="#": cnt+=1 else: cnt-=1 cnt = max(0,cnt) mx = max(mx,cnt) print(ans+mx-1)